Lecturer in Landscape Architecture

Job Details

University of Colorado | Denver

Official Title: Lecturer
Working Title: Lecturer in Landscape Architecture
FTE: Part-time
Salary: $5,618 for a 3-credit hour course. $8,322 for a 6-credit hour course.

This posting establishes a pool of candidates who can teach one studio or technical seminar per semester in Landscape Architecture on an as needed basis. This posting does not necessarily reflect a current, open position. Single course appointments will be made semester-by-semester, as teaching needs arise. This temporary Lecturer pool is anticipated to remain continuously active through August 2025, at which point, all applications will be cleared from the pool. Applicants will be welcome to apply to future pools after that date.

Lecturer What you will do: The Department of Landscape Architecture in the College of Architecture and Planning at the University of Colorado Denver is seeking a pool of Lecturers from which future appointments will be made. Lecturers selected from this pool will teach in the College’s graduate program. Classes taught may range from three to six credit hours and may include lectures, seminars, and studios in all teaching modes (in-person, hybrid, online, remote).

Qualifications:

Minimum Qualifications

  • A master’s degree in Landscape Architecture or a related field, or a terminal degree and expertise in the course content is required.
  • Applicants must meet minimum qualifications at the time of hire.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Preference may be given to applicants with prior teaching experience, a record of professional practice in landscape architecture, and a professional degree in a related field.
  • Applicants for courses addressing specific subjects are also given consideration based on the course needs; in this case, they must have an advanced degree or proven expertise in the topic.
  • Applicants should have substantive knowledge of the landscape architecture field and/or the subject matter which they will be teaching.
